RESUMO
A protein with a molecular mass of 22 kDa was purified from the cellulosic parenchyma of cassava roots. The amino acid composition of the protein was determined and antibodies generated against the purified protein were used to show that the concentration of the protein remains unchanged during root "tuber" formation. By using a tissue printing technique, as well as weatern blot, it was shown that the cellulosic parenchyma was the only root tissue in which the protein was deposited
